It was a big job, brought in the mini dozer and 4 laborers to turn, level and pack the dirt on the entire front lawn area.. Then the thick black trap was laid down first to prevent weeds from growing up. Big truck was brought in to deliver the lawn turf in huge rolls, black tarp too.. Then the turf was laid down, cut, stretched and staked to the ground.. Borders were set in place, rocks poured.. Fountain lights set and installed, etc...
In the end it took 3 days to complete.. Oh and the life expectancy is guaranteed for 10 years but should last longer..
I did the math prior to installing it, before I was paying a gardener $100 a month + extras (fert, weed and sot patching, sprinkler system maintenance which probably all totaled to maybe $120 a month on Average. Water bill probably $25 a month to water the lawn daily and keep it really green and perfect looking.. That all added up to $1740 a year x 10 years which equals $16,400... Turf lawn with warranty and maintenance free for 10 years was $9300.00 .. No brainer, done deal...
